Our friends over at Doctors Hospital at White Rock Lake received a little attention from NBCDFW (KXAS-TV Channel 5) yesterday.
Reporter Ashanti Blaize did a piece, website and broadcast, on the hospital’s use of LifeNet, a remote system by which emergency medical personnel send a heart-attack patient’s vital life signs and electrocardiogram, EKG, data from an ambulance to the awaiting emergency department, the physician, and the catheterization laboratory.
The system saves precious time and lives.
